  11. Played for about an hour this morning and really enjoyed it. It’s def a Souls game and plays like a souls game with jumping. But I choose a magic knight character so the other might play different. The world def gives off a Breath of the Wild feel in that there’s tons of “ohh that looks like something/cool” and you go check it out and there’s pretty much always something to find. I both wanted to just wander around and felt rewarded for doing so. There’s a great new mechanic where you get 1 estus restored after defeating a group of enemies(groups can be as small as 2). Which is great because it’s not like you’re tripping over rest points and it’s nice to no have to be forced to reset all the enemies in the world after stumbling onto one boss. Still haven’t figured out how to get the mount, although I suspect it might have to do with killing a mounted mini boss near the beginning. But I’m suuuuper rusty at these games so I haven’t been able to kill him yet. Overall I’m really loving it so far and can’t wait for the next window to open.
